| Hi, an app I'm trying (SyncTunes) need a Phone/PDA volume to be mounted on the Macs desktop in order to to its job. I'm presently syncing my Nokia 6233 with the Mac successfully (needed the Novamedias iSync plugin though) but it's done over Bluetooth and no volume gets mounted. If I get connected over USB instead, would that help me? TIA Mans |

| I don't know this particular model of Nokia, but my N73 after connecting with USB asks me what I want to do - when I choose Media transfer, volume appears on my desktop. |
